Is 686 865 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 686 865 is about 828.773.

Thus, the square root of 686 865 is not an integer, and therefore 686 865 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 686 865?

The square of a number (here 686 865) is the result of the product of this number (686 865) by itself (i.e., 686 865 × 686 865); the square of 686 865 is sometimes called "raising 686 865 to the power 2", or "686 865 squared".

The square of 686 865 is 471 783 528 225 because 686 865 × 686 865 = 686 8652 = 471 783 528 225.

As a consequence, 686 865 is the square root of 471 783 528 225.
